I don't know how many of you visit the official site, but Adam Baldwin is a regular poster there. It just so happens he's in Vancouver working on an episode of SG-1 and spending his spare time in internet cafes to keep up with the fans. It was brought to Adam's attention that one of the board regulars, Lux Lucre, lives in Vancouver. So, Adam got in touch with him and invited him out to a local bar for a couple of beers! As if that's not cool enough, Alan Tudyk was also in town filming 'I Robot' and dropped by. Here's a link to the thread...
http://forums.prospero.com/foxfirefly/messages/?msg=8299.137
Lux posted some pictures on his web site to boot. Lux is a cool guy and I couldn't think of a more deserving Firefly Fan. He was also kind enough to share some really interesting stories with the board, as well as some inside info on the series and the upcoming movie.(sounds like its definitely THE project Joss is working on). Other highlights:
Lux: "About the future I can talk about. Looks like it will be a Universal studios project, and the script is still to be approved, but odds look good that the whole cast will be free to start filming this fall."
Lux: "Adam told me a lot of behind-the-scenes information about the show and why it got cancelled that I promised to keep confidential. Let me just say that those who think someone had it in for the show from the beginning were right."
Lux: "In the early days, just after Alan had gotten the nod to play Wash (hey did you know the guy who played Dobson was up for Wash?), alan wanted to give Joss a special present so he commisioned his sister who was a painter to paint a large portrait of Joss as a child clutching a glass jar containing a firefly in it, with dark men in suits mencing him from the shadows.
It was ment to be ironic, something they could look to years later an laugh as paranoa, but sadly it turned out to be all too real.
I suggested that Alan get a photo of it for the DVDs and he thought that would be a good idea."
